DBHawk features and specs

  • Web-Based
    DBHawk is a web-based database management tool, which means you can access it from any device with an internet connection, reducing the need for client installations.
  • Multi-Database Support
    The tool supports a wide range of databases like Oracle, MySQL, SQL Server, PostgreSQL, and more, making it versatile for different database environments.
  • User-Friendly Interface
    DBHawk offers an intuitive and user-friendly interface that helps both novice and experienced DBAs manage databases efficiently.
  • Security Features
    It includes robust security features like role-based access control, SSL encryption, and auditing to help ensure your database environment remains secure.
  • Query Builder
    The tool has an advanced SQL query builder that allows users to create complex queries without deep SQL knowledge.
  • Real-Time Monitoring
    DBHawk provides real-time monitoring features, allowing users to track performance metrics and troubleshoot issues promptly.

Flexera Software Vulnerability Manager features and specs

  • Comprehensive Vulnerability Database
    Flexera Software Vulnerability Manager offers a robust and extensive database of software vulnerabilities, ensuring users have access to the most up-to-date and comprehensive information.
  • Automated Patch Management
    Automates the process of identifying, prioritizing, and deploying patches, saving time and reducing the risk of human error in manual patching efforts.
  • Customizable Reports
    Provides detailed and customizable reports that help organizations understand their vulnerability landscape and compliance status, facilitating informed decision-making.
  • Integration Capabilities
    Offers seamless integration with other security and IT management tools, enhancing the overall efficiency and effectiveness of a organization’s security posture.
  • Real-Time Alerts
    Provides real-time alerts on new vulnerabilities and patches, helping organizations to swiftly respond to emerging security threats.
